Changed defaults in Splitfork, our assignment service. Bucketing now uses sticky hashing per account instead of per session, and the holdout slice grew from 2% to 5%. Callers relying on session-level reassignment must opt in explicitly. Review the diff against the new baseline; the updated default configuration is listed below.

config for tagep-kajof:
[casir]
port = 6379
region = south-1
host = casir.paliqdyn.example
team = tamax
timeout_ms = 250
retries = 2

## Step 4: Migrate your permission checks

Heads up, plugin authors: Wikibarrow 5 replaces the old flat ACLs with role-based access. Your plugin must now ask for a role capability instead of a user flag, so swap any `can_edit` checks for `role.has("edit")`. Roles are stored server-side; to test against a migrated instance, point your dev build at the database below.

warehouse DSN: clickhouse://druys_svc:Pl@db-47e1.orvexstack.corp:5432/beldor

# Break-Glass: Catalog Cache Invalidation

Scope: the Pinrow product catalog at Veldstone Retail. If stale prices persist after a purge and the Hollowmere invalidation queue is wedged, use break-glass to flush the edge tier directly. Contractors: get verbal sign-off from the catalog lead first. Steps: open the Hollowmere admin shell, select emergency-flush, confirm the tenant, and run it once — repeated flushes thrash the origin. Access is logged and expires after 20 minutes. Unseal the admin shell with the passphrase below.

recovery phrase for kahop-tajog: istix-casvan

Ticket: FD-hunter config drifted between staging and prod

While chasing the leaked file descriptors in the Gobbin ingest workers, I noticed our fd-hunter tooling runs with different sampling settings in each environment — staging flags leaks that prod silently misses. That's probably why the last hunt came up empty. Let's pin one canonical config. For reference, here's what prod is actually running.

deployment values, bagaf-kagag:
istael:
  pin: 2777
  tenant: tamvan
  seal: seal_75cefd5e
  metrics_host: metrics.istael.qirvanio.example
  standby_team: holion
  escalation: kelmir-drudor
  nonce: d13cd7